520    "Less stuff" during this most stressful and expensive time
       of year can mean "less busy" and leave you with "more 
       peace". Meg Nordmann will guide you through shifting your 
       mindset towards accumulation, having hard conversations, 
       clearing your calendar, and holiday-specific decluttering,
       with a focus on intentionality and presence to make room 
       for what really matters in life.--From back cover.
